MDAO Update: Removal of Council Member Taylor

According to the MDAO Charter, MDAO concils decided to remove Council Taylor from his role. Reason: Lack of active participation in AstroDAO voting and regular checking for updates at least once per week. Lack of maintaining regular communication with other Council members, and the community as necessary to achieve the Marketing DAO’s objectives.

https://app.astrodao.com/dao/marketing.sputnik-dao.near/proposals/marketing.sputnik-dao.near-866

According to MDAO Charter, MDAO councils decided to elect a new council and open submissions for the role:

  1. Individuals aspiring to become Council Members must create a proposal on the Governance Forum expressing their interest and providing a detailed explanation of how they meet the eligibility criteria.
  2. The NEAR community is encouraged to provide feedback and show support for Council candidates, fostering a collaborative and inclusive process.
  3. Existing Council Members will assess the incoming proposals, considering the eligibility criteria, community feedback, and any concerns raised.
  4. A decision will be made based on these considerations, and the reasoning for the decision must be communicated clearly to ensure transparency and understanding

Criteria for Eligibility for Council Members

To ensure the effectiveness and success of the Marketing DAO, Council members must meet the following criteria and uphold the standards set forth in their role. Failure to meet these criteria may result in removal from the Council.

  1. Be the Face of Marketing DAO:
  • Inspire trust and confidence in leadership by representing the Marketing DAO with integrity and professionalism, ensuring at all times their actions do not bring the DAO into disrepute.
  1. Spend a Reasonable Amount of Time Within the Ecosystem:
  • Have a deep understanding of the NEAR ecosystem, including knowledge of key players, trends, needs, and opportunities in the blockchain space.
  1. Assess Incoming Proposals:
  • Evaluate and assess incoming proposals in a timely manner, with the first assessment completed within 10 days.
  • Provide detailed reasoning to justify decision-making, ensuring transparency and accountability.
  • Ensure that the decision-making process and outcomes are well-documented and easily understandable to external parties.
  1. Governance:
  • Actively participate in AstroDAO voting and regularly check for updates at least once per week.
  • Maintain regular communication with other Council members, trustees, and the community as necessary to achieve the Marketing DAO’s objectives.
  1. Take Ownership of Everyday Operations:
  • Identify and execute necessary tasks to achieve the Marketing DAO’s objectives, going beyond ideas to successful execution.
  • Examples of tasks may include managing the Marketing DAO website, migrating to NEAR Social, handling social media accounts, hosting regular spaces, and conducting office hours.
  1. Lead Strategic Projects:
  • Demonstrate the ability to think critically, identify problems, and identify areas of opportunity.
  • Create hypotheses and design experiments to address identified problems and opportunities.
  • Proactively establish partnerships and engage with third parties to advance the Marketing DAO’s strategic objectives.
  • Write bounties and define the scope of experiments, including clear objectives and criteria for success.
  1. NDC Engagement:
  • Stay informed and up to date with the latest developments and activities within the NEAR Digital Collective (NDC).
  • Provide regular input and representation of the Marketing DAO’s interests within the NDC.
  • Ensure that the Marketing DAO has a reputable presence and ongoing standing within the NEAR ecosystem.

Council Members:

  1. Council Members form the decision-making body of the Marketing DAO.
  2. They are responsible for managing the day-to-day operations of the DAO and making informed judgments on incoming proposals and strategic initiatives.
  3. Council Members consider the alignment of proposals with the DAO’s objectives and guiding principles, contributing to the overall growth and success of the NEAR ecosystem.
  4. Liaise with Trustees and participate in monthly requests for proposals (RFPs) to advance the Marketing DAO’s goals.

Council members are expected to meet these eligibility criteria and actively contribute to the growth, development, and success of the Marketing DAO. Regular assessment and adherence to these standards ensure the effectiveness of the Council and the achievement of the Marketing DAO’s objectives.
